import os import csv import cv2 VIDEO_EXTENSIONS = [".mp4", ".webm", ".mkv"] def list_video_files(folder_path): return [f for f in os.listdir(folder_path) if os.path.splitext(f)[1].lower() in VIDEO_EXTENSIONS] def load_csv(csv_path): with open(csv_path, 'r', newline='', encoding='utf-8') as csv_file: reader = csv.reader(csv_file) next(reader) # Skip header return list(reader) def save_csv(csv_path, data): with open(csv_path, 'w', newline='', encoding='utf-8') as csv_file: writer = csv.writer(csv_file) writer.writerow(["filename", "label"]) writer.writerows(data) def find_first_unlabeled(data): for i, row in enumerate(data): if row[1] == '-1': return i return -1 def create_label_csv(folder_path, csv_file_path): video_files = list_video_files(folder_path) if not video_files: print(f"No video files found in {folder_path}") return folder_name = os.path.basename(folder_path) csv_file_path = os.path.join(csv_file_path, f"{folder_name}.csv") with open(csv_file_path, mode='w', newline='', encoding='utf-8') as csv_file: writer = csv.writer(csv_file) writer.writerow(["filename", "label"]) for video_file in video_files: writer.writerow([video_file, -1]) print(f"CSV file created: {csv_file_path}") def play_video(video_path): cap = cv2.VideoCapture(video_path) if not cap.isOpened(): print(f"Failed to open video: {video_path}") return print("Press 'q' to end view.") while True: ret, frame = cap.read() if not ret: break cv2.imshow(os.path.basename(video_path), frame) if cv2.waitKey(25) & 0xFF == ord('q'): break cap.release() cv2.destroyAllWindows() def label_videos(folder_path, csv_file_path): csv_path = os.path.join(csv_file_path, f"{os.path.basename(folder_path)}.csv") if not os.path.exists(csv_path): print(f"CSV file not found: {csv_path}, creating...") create_label_csv(folder_path, csv_file_path) data = load_csv(csv_path) total_videos = len(data) unlabeled_index = find_first_unlabeled(data) if unlabeled_index == -1: print("All videos are labeled.") return while unlabeled_index < total_videos: video_name, label = data[unlabeled_index] video_path = os.path.join(folder_path, video_name) print(f"Current video: {video_name}") print(f"Progress: {unlabeled_index + 1}/{total_videos} ({(unlabeled_index + 1) / total_videos * 100:.2f}%)") play_video(video_path) while True: label_input = input("Enter label (0, 1, 2), 'w' to exit, 'r' to replay: ") if label_input in ['0', '1', '2']: data[unlabeled_index][1] = label_input save_csv(csv_path, data) print(f"Label {label_input} saved for {video_name}.") break elif label_input == 'w': print("Exiting") return elif label_input == 'r': print(f"Replaying {video_name}") play_video(video_path) else: print("Invalid input. Please enter 0, 1, 2, 'w' or 'r'.") unlabeled_index = find_first_unlabeled(data) if unlabeled_index == -1: print("All videos are labeled.") break if __name__ == "__main__": batch_folder = "./batch_0" csv_file_path = './' label_videos(batch_folder, csv_file_path)
